Blawenburg Band sets anniversary concert May 21

   MONTGOMERY — The Blawenburg Band will celebrate 115 years with an anniversary concert on Saturday, May 21, at the Montgomery High School auditorium.
   The 70-piece concert band — one of the oldest in the state — will perform well-known favorites, as well as premieres of two new compositions.
   The concert will begin at 8 p.m. and is free and open to the public.
   Dr. Jerry Rife, professor of music at Rider University, conducts the Blawenburg Band, which performs more than 30 concerts a year.
   After the concert, there will be a Dixieland session in the school lunchroom with refreshments.
